Output de3fc12dac187502408c51d78e4d91bb332cbb5d1fcecd2861b0ef858bbb0d29:1

value
31582570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8aa213e6905f4f75d80091055c8b340c1805c658448c3313f193497bc0cd8b9
address
tb1pez4zz0nfqh60whvqpyg9tj9ngrqcqhr9s3yvxvflry6f00qvmzuszawtts
transaction
de3fc12dac187502408c51d78e4d91bb332cbb5d1fcecd2861b0ef858bbb0d29
spent
true